Here, for the first time, is the definitive practical guide to setting up a choral or instrumental ensemble and running it effectively.
Aimed at experienced solo musicians, it illustrates how to harness individual skills to build an exciting and creative group dynamic. Every aspect of performing together is covered, from choosing repertoire and arranging the music to devising innovative rehearsal techniques, allleading to that successful final performance.
Both a step-by-step ‘how to' book, and a comprehensive reference resource, How To Create a Successful Music Ensemble features the insights of several experienced musical directors and also covers topics like practicalities, publicity and conducting techniques.
With illuminating real-life case studies throughout, How To Create a Successful Music Ensemble is the ultimate guide to every practical and artistic aspect of creating and maintaining one of music's most rewarding collaborative forms.
About the author.
Patrick Gazard has over 20 years experience in music and music education, during which he has run numerous youth and adult ensembles, with several of his groups reaching the final stages of national competitions.
Now a freelance teacher and conductor/ composer, Patrick is also an arranger for Music Sales and Banks Music Publications.
